The Persia Beal House is a historic house on the north side of Chesham Road in Harrisville, New Hampshire. It is now the Harrisville Inn. The 2.5 story wood frame house was built c. 1842, and is one of the best-preserved 19th century connected farmsteads in the town. The property is also notable for its association with Worcester, Massachusetts businessman Arthur E. Childs, who purchased the property to serve as the estate farm for his nearby Aldworth Manor summer estate.
The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1988.
